Like me, you may have gone to The University of Memphis. You may just be a Tigers homer. You might cheer on our baseball, football, basketball, or soccer teams - or any one of the eighteen Division I teams that compete in the American Athletic Conference.
Whatever your sport, judging from the crowds at the sporting events, the only words we know to the U of M fight song are "Go, Tigers Go!". Ha!
It's ok - there's plenty of time to learn the words to the fight song before the next game. Assignment #2 on the list of 365 Things To Do is to do just that.
The fight song, which is called "Go! Tigers! Go!" was written in the mid-1960s by Tom Ferguson, the university's Director of Bands.
The good news for those of us who are going to learn the words today is that they're easy:
"Go, Tigers go, go on to victory
Be a winner through and through
Fight Tigers, fight, 'cause we're going all the way
Fight, fight for the blue and gray and say
Let's Go Tigers Go,
Go On To Victory.
See Our Colors Bright And True;
It's Fight Now Without A Fear,
Fight Now Let's Shout A Cheer,
Shout For Dear Memphis U.
(Yell)
Go Tigers Go
Go Tigers Go!"
